Cowboy Magic
 


© Kurt Van der Elst

Going through the beginning of my movie again. Not once, but ten times: “A man in the desert, his feet in the sand. Mountains on his right, the dunes on his left. And he with only some sugar in his pocket and a fan in his hand. He waits… We don’t know why. Nothing moves. Nor his body, neither the fan. Only the clouds and his ideas. And we watch his face. He doesn’t say anything. We just get the impression he wants to say something there in the desert.”

And the wind will come – to open my head with the sound of a scooter and the words of the people I try to love. “Let the wind come. And blow the sand over me.”

Written and performed by: Mohamed Bari
Direction & text coaching: Ivan Vrambout
Sound decor: Laurent Taquin
Light & technique: Guy Carbonnelle & Luc Volon
Artistic collaboration: Didier de Neck
Scenography: team of the Galafronie
Costumes: Olivia Mortier
Production & sales: Pascale Vanbressem
Production assistance: Yves Robic
Produced by: Théâtre de Galafronie
Co-production: Action Malaise
With the support of Théâtre de la Balsamine and the Ministry of the French Community
